Lady Caroline Lamb (November 13, 1785 – January 26, 1828) is a British aristocrat and novelist, best known for her affair with Lord Byron in 1812.
Her husband is the 2nd Viscount Melbourne, who later becomes Prime Minister.
However, she is never the Viscountess Melbourne because she died before Melbourne succeeds to the peerage; hence, she is known to history as Lady Caroline Lamb.
She i the only daughter of the 3rd Earl of Bessborough and Henrietta, Countess of Bessborough, and related to other leading society ladies, being the niece of Georgiana Cavendish, Duchess of Devonshire, and cousin (by marriage) of Annabella, Lady Byron.
